Mellier visits Orapa
Page Content
17
th
August 2011
The new De Beers Group CEO, Mr Philippe Mellier will on Thursday August 18
th
, 2011 visit Orapa and Letlhakane Mines (OLM) as part of his familiarisation of the De Beers Family of Companies (FoCs) operations, following his appointment earlier this year. During his visit to OLM, Mr Mellier will be taken through an update of OLM’s performance to date. He will also take a tour of the Orapa Mine, Debswana’s oldest operation.
Mr Mellier recently undertook a visit to the world’s richest mine by value, Jwaneng Mine where he was given an update on the performance of the Debswana operation. During his visit to Jwaneng Mine, he indicated that he was very excited to be at the “Prince of Mines” to get a fuller appreciation of the business that contributes significantly to Botswana and the FOCs.
Mr Mellier was appointed De Beers CEO in May, 2011 and took up his position last month.
